Job Description

Job Summary We are seeking an energetic and visionary Plant Manager to lead the launch and operational excellence of a new manufacturing facility. This pivotal role involves overseeing all aspects of plant setup, production, quality assurance, and administrative functions. The ideal candidate will drive continuous improvement initiatives, implement lean manufacturing principles, and ensure seamless integration of systems such as SAP, ERP, and MRP to optimize supply chain management and operational efficiency. As a key leader, you will inspire teams across production, quality, IT, paint operations, and administration to achieve excellence from day one. Duties Lead the planning, construction, and commissioning of the new plant, establishing robust processes for production management and operational workflows. Develop and execute production strategies aligned with business goals, utilizing
SAP, ERP
systems, and MRP for effective production planning and supply chain analytics. Implement lean manufacturing principles to streamline processes, reduce waste, and foster a culture of continuous improvement across all departments. Oversee quality control initiatives to ensure products meet stringent standards; lead process improvements to enhance product quality and operational efficiency. Manage supply chain activities including procurement, inventory management, logistics coordination, and supplier relationships to ensure timely delivery and cost optimization. Supervise departmental managers—including Quality Managers, Production Engineers, Paint Supervisors, IT specialists, and Administrative staff—to foster collaboration and accountability. Drive mechanical knowledge application in maintenance planning and process optimization; promote safety standards and compliance throughout the plant. Utilize manufacturing data to analyze operations performance; identify opportunities for process enhancement using tools like Lean methodologies. Support the integration of IT systems to improve operational visibility; oversee system upgrades or implementations related to ERP or manufacturing software. Qualifications Proven experience in plant management within a manufacturing environment with a strong background in production management and operations leadership. Extensive knowledge of
SAP, ERP
systems, MRP processes, and supply chain management tools including analytics for decision-making. Demonstrated expertise in lean manufacturing techniques, process improvement strategies, and continuous improvement initiatives. Strong understanding of manufacturing processes including assembly lines, paint operations (if applicable), mechanical systems, and quality control standards. Excellent leadership skills with the ability to manage cross-functional teams such as QE (Quality Engineering), Production Managers, Quality Managers, IT specialists, Paint Supervisors, and Administrative personnel. Mechanical knowledge relevant to plant machinery maintenance and process optimization is highly desirable. Exceptional organizational skills with the ability to develop strategic plans for new plant startup; capable of managing multiple priorities effectively. Strong communication skills with a proactive approach to problem-solving; committed to fostering a safety-conscious work environment.
